The ASUS Zenbook Flip S13 is more portable and has a higher resolution screen, which is excellent for general use, but it has less powerful graphics than the MSI Summit E16 Flip, making the MSI better for 3D rendering, machine learning, and engineering tasks. If portability and a high-resolution touch display for general tasks are key, the ASUS Zenbook Flip S13 offers a compelling package. On the other hand, if you need a laptop for high-performance tasks and can handle a larger, heavier device, the MSI Summit E16 Flip, with its dedicated GPU and larger screen, will be more suitable. Both are premium laptops with similar storage, RAM, and touchscreens, but the MSI has extra gaming capabilities and a more recent release date. Give Feedback

About ASUS

ASUS, a Taiwanese electronics brand, is one of the largest personal computer vendor by market share. The majority of their laptops are targeted towards personal use or gaming. Their most popular product lines include the budget-friendly VivoBook, more premium ZenBook, and their TUF and ROG gaming laptops, the latter of which has a reputation for excellent gaming performance.

About MSI

MSI, also known as Micro-Star International, is a Taiwanese technology corporation. MSI is known for their wide range of gaming devices. Their series include the entry-level Cyborg/Thin and Sword/Katana series, the mid-range Bravo/Delta and Crosshair/Pulse series, and their high-end Vector, Raider, Stealth, and Titan GT series. At every performance level, MSI offers a variety of devices with varying balances between performance, battery life, weight, and price, making them a solid option to consider at every price point.
